#5361e1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5361e1 is composed of 32.5% red, 38% green and 88.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.1% cyan, 56.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 234.1 degrees, a saturation of 70.3% and a lightness of 60.4%. #5361e1 color hex could be obtained by blending #a6c2ff with #0000c3.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

#5361e1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5361e1 has RGB values of R:83, G:97, B:225 and CMYK values of C:0.63, M:0.57, Y:0,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 5464545.

Shades and Tints of #5361e1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02030c is the darkest color, while #fafafe is the lightest one.

Tones of #5361e1
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#99999b is the less saturated color, while #3c4ef8 is the most saturated one.
